Using a Scroll, still need Somatic Component?

I can't find the RAW that explains this, although I'm sure it's someplace obvious. If casting a spell from a scroll that has a somatic component, do you still need the hand free etc., do you still need to actively do the somatic gesture to cast the spell?

Spell Completion
This is the activation method for scrolls. A scroll is a spell that is mostly finished. The preparation is done for the caster, so no preparation time is needed beforehand as with normal spellcasting. All that’s left to do is perform the finishing parts of the spellcasting (the final gestures, words, and so on). To use a spell completion item safely, a character must be of high enough level in the right class to cast the spell already. If he can’t already cast the spell, there’s a chance he’ll make a mistake. Activating a spell completion item is a standard action and provokes attacks of opportunity exactly as casting a spell does.
